What is there to say about this album that hasn't been said?
These French dance nerds have been making awesome music for a decade.
And here we are in 2009 (or 2010 cos I suck at posting), dancing to this album.
Yes you've heard their songs everywhere. And 1901 should make you want to buy a Cadillac.
Buy this album now. You don't want your kids to know you were lame in 2009.
No comments:
Post a Comment